2017-03-09 9 views
3

フェードメソッドを使用して、imageViewで画像を順次表示したいとします。第1の画像の効果は正しいが、第2の画像は全く表示されず、第3の画像にスキップされる。 アルファが1.0であることがわかるように、画像を完全に見えるようにしたので、これをチェックして構文が正しいことがわかります。 BARTは、描画可能なフォルダ内のImageViewのの、画像の名前フェードメソッドを使用しても画像が表示されません

ImageView bart= (ImageView) findViewById(R.id.bart); 
     bart.animate().alpha((float)1.0).setDuration(1000); 
     bart.setImageResource(R.drawable.homer); 
     bart.animate().alpha((float)1.0).setDuration(1000); 
     bart.setImageResource(R.drawable.lisa); 

答えて

1

あなただけのアニメーションを定義し、それを開始したことがありません両方です。アニメーションコールチェーンの最後に 'start()'を追加します。

関連する問題